Although I'm not sure what Code: 2d80 is, when viewing your connection attempts with American Express from our end, I see an FDP-350 error, which indicates an invalid or expired token. To establish a fresh connection with the bank and gain a new access token, please follow these steps:
- Navigate to the bank's website, sign in, and remove Quicken's access from the bank's third-party linked apps.
- Navigate back to Quicken Simplifi and make all of the accounts with this bank manual by following the steps here.
- Once you see the account(s) listed in the Manual Accounts section under Settings > Accounts, go back through the Add Account flow to reconnect to the bank.
- Carefully link the account(s) found to your existing Quicken Simplifi account(s) by following the steps here.
